Automattic\Jetpack_Boost\Modules\Modules_Setup S

Total Complexity 49
Dependencies 12
Dependents 6
Total lines 252
Lines of code 164
Logical lines of code 95
Comment lines 42
Methods 15
Properties 2

Methods 15

Method Rating Maintainability Complexity Lines of code
on_module_status_update()
A
49 11 32
register_always_available_endpoints()
S
58 6 16
notice_page_output_change_of_module()
S
58 5 16
init_modules()
S
59 4 14
get_available_modules()
S
64 3 10
get_available_submodules()
S
64 3 10
get_ready_active_optimization_modules()
S
66 3 9
setup_features_data_sync()
S
65 3 9
register_endpoints()
S
66 3 9
get_status()
S
68 2 7
setup()
S
63 2 10
register_data_sync()
S
62 1 12
__construct()
S
76 1 4
get_available_modules_and_submodules()
S
79 1 3
load_modules()
S
81 1 3